Great neighbourhood to go on a stroll! : Greenwich Village Walk is a cool bohemian hangout which is also a residential district in Manhattan. We loved strolling through the neighborhood. There are so many places to see including The Stonewall Inn, Marie’s Crisis Cafe, Grove Court, Edna St. Vincent Millay House and Chumley’s. Highly recommended! |

A fan of the architecture and the display! : Yet another art museum which was formerly a millionaire industrialist's home. There is some interesting display of Western European art. The entry fee was quite steep, about $22. This was one of our favorite museums and we loved the architecture here too. Highly recommended if you are an art lover! |

A beautiful ferry travel experience! : Ther ferry experience was really good and enjoyable. It was, in fact, one of the best ways for us to see Manhatten and Brooklyn. You can even see the Statue of Liberty from the ferry too. The ride was about 25 minutes one way. The ferry was clean and well maintained too. The view of Ellis Island was picturesque. |

360 degree views of the city: This is the observatory on top of Rockefeller Center which gives you a 360-degree view of the New York City. There are some outdoor and indoor viewing areas which give you access to the stunning views of the skyline. Everything was so amazing, starting from the elevator ride up and the views. On travel, tip is to book your tickets in advance. |
